Output 99d4f5612cd8062eb7cb8a2968e2e269d3d2081ce65391d5d12d19284b5e351b:1

value
301605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9a8cb7354e048f58fce0ed92051597f094bd1e8 OP_EQUAL
address
3HA6L2VCuipq9LeUffps9wYVopunQ9eZR3
transaction
99d4f5612cd8062eb7cb8a2968e2e269d3d2081ce65391d5d12d19284b5e351b
spent
true